A few weeks ago I wrote a blog post about the need for data privacy and data protection. My point was, that there might be legal requirements, that have to be taken in to concern, but it is your own interest to go beyond that.

In Germany there is the law about data privacy (Bundesdatenschutzgesetz); it contains a big part which is about protecting employees data (BDSG § 32). But there is more than employees data you also might want to protect, just to mention some:

  • Bill of materials
  • Purchase price
  • Sales prices and conditions
  • Customer- and Vendordata

Especially when data gets extracted and saved on external media like USB sticks or external hard disks, the built-in data security methods like a proper authorization concept, firewalls and the company network in general do not work anymore. Because of that it should always be considered, if data should be made anonymous or encrypted during export.
